Evie, I noticed that you changed "1. Party Pokémon 1-6 have over 0 current HP if over 0 max HP." to "1. Party Pokémon 1-6 have over 0 max HP if >0 current HP." Those do not seem to be the same condition: By my reading, if you have a fainted ordinary Pokémon, then it doesn't satisfy the first condition, but do satisfy the second condition. To dissatisfy the second condition, you probably need a glitched Pokémon with 0 max HP and >0 current HP. The first condition seems more likely to be a concern, but I guess when it comes to glitching, everything is possible. Do you have some evidence that shows that the second condition is correct? Basically, 0/0 (0 current HP, 0 maximum HP) is allowed but 1/0 (1 current HP 0 maximum HP), 2/0 etc. are not as these cause a freeze, possibly a division by zero in HP bar calculations. Anything else (including e.g. a fainted Pokémon with 20 maximum HP) is allowed in slots 1-6. I think the original condition text before it was changed may have been a mistake when I made that video in 2015. Will test this again from a new save with memory editor one moment. I see. The "division by zero" explanation makes sense. However, that would mean that the freeze is really a separate glitch and does not have much to do with this glitch. I don't think this kind of "requirement" needs to be stated in the article, as it is common sense that all Pokémon used in a glitch experiment should not be freeze-causing by themselves (otherwise there are probably many articles that need such "requirements"). I think we should first make a page for the other glitch anyway; then, if the setup method of this glitch makes it easy to get 0 max HP Pokémon, we can mention something along the lines of "furthermore, none of party Pokémon 1-6 should cause a zero maximum HP glitch".
